The amount of chromatic aberration depends on the dispersion of the glass. ... Doublet for Chromatic Aberration ... The use of a strong positive lens made from a low dispersion glass like crown glass coupled with a weaker high dispersion glass like flint glass can correct the chromatic aberration for two colors, e.g., red and blue.
